The __words__ keyword index stores 50-5000 entries per entity (one per word), which inflated avg entries/entity well above the corruption threshold of 100. This caused: 1. validateConsistency() to falsely detect corruption on every startup, triggering unnecessary clearAllIndexData() + rebuild() cycles 2. getStats() to log false "Metadata index may be corrupted" warnings and report inflated totalEntries/totalIds stats Both methods now skip __words__ when counting, so stats and health checks reflect metadata fields only (noun, type, createdAt, etc.). Keyword search is unaffected since the __words__ field index itself is not modified.

## Overview
|
||
|
||
Cloudflare R2 is an S3-compatible object storage with **zero egress fees**, making it ideal for high-traffic applications. Brainy fully supports R2 with lifecycle policies and batch operations.
|
||
|
||
## Cost Breakdown
|
||
|
||
### R2 Pricing (As of 2025)
|
||
|
||
```
|
||
Storage: $0.015/GB/month
|
||
Class A Operations (write): $4.50 per million
|
||
Class B Operations (read): $0.36 per million
|
||
Egress: $0.00 (FREE!)
|
||
```

### Comparison to AWS S3 (500TB Dataset)
|
||
|
||
**AWS S3 Standard:**
|
||
```
|
||
Storage: 500TB × $0.023/GB × 12 = $138,000/year
|
||
Egress (assume 100TB/month): 1.2PB × $0.09/GB = $108,000/year
|
||
Operations: $5,000/year
|
||
Total: $251,000/year
|
||
```
|
||
|
||
**Cloudflare R2 Standard:**
|
||
```
|
||
Storage: 500TB × $0.015/GB × 12 = $90,000/year
|
||
Egress: $0 (FREE!)
|
||
Operations: $5,000/year
|
||
Total: $95,000/year
|
||
Savings vs AWS: $156,000/year (62%)
|
||
```

## Strategy 1: Use R2 Standard (Current Best Practice)
|
||
|
||
### Setup: S3-Compatible API
|
||
|
||
```typescript
|
||
import { Brainy } from '@soulcraft/brainy'
|
||
import { S3CompatibleStorage } from '@soulcraft/brainy/storage'
|
||
|
||
// R2 uses S3-compatible API
|
||
const storage = new S3CompatibleStorage({
|
||
endpoint: `https://${process.env.R2_ACCOUNT_ID}.r2.cloudflarestorage.com`,
|
||
bucket: 'my-brainy-data',
|
||
region: 'auto', // R2 uses 'auto' region
|
||
accessKeyId: process.env.R2_ACCESS_KEY_ID,
|
||
secretAccessKey: process.env.R2_SECRET_ACCESS_KEY
|
||
})
|
||
|
||
const brain = new Brainy({ storage })
|
||
await brain.init()
|
||
```

## Batch Operations
|
||
|
||
### Efficient Bulk Deletions
|
||
|
||
```typescript
|
||
// R2 supports S3 batch delete API
|
||
const idsToDelete = [/* array of entity IDs */]
|
||
|
||
const paths = idsToDelete.flatMap(id => {
|
||
const shard = id.substring(0, 2)
|
||
return [
|
||
`entities/nouns/vectors/${shard}/${id}.json`,
|
||
`entities/nouns/metadata/${shard}/${id}.json`
|
||
]
|
||
})
|
||
|
||
// Batch delete (1000 objects per request)
|
||
await storage.batchDelete(paths)
|
||
|
||
// Cost impact:
|
||
// - Individual deletes: 1M × $4.50/1M = $4.50
|
||
// - Batch deletes: 1k batches × $4.50/1M = $0.0045 (1000x cheaper!)
|
||
```

## Migration from S3 to R2
|
||
|
||
### Using rclone
|
||
|
||
```bash
|
||
# Install rclone
|
||
brew install rclone # or apt-get install rclone
|
||
|
||
# Configure S3 source
|
||
rclone config create s3-source s3 \
|
||
access_key_id=$AWS_ACCESS_KEY \
|
||
secret_access_key=$AWS_SECRET_KEY \
|
||
region=us-east-1
|
||
|
||
# Configure R2 destination
|
||
rclone config create r2-dest s3 \
|
||
access_key_id=$R2_ACCESS_KEY \
|
||
secret_access_key=$R2_SECRET_KEY \
|
||
endpoint=https://$R2_ACCOUNT_ID.r2.cloudflarestorage.com \
|
||
region=auto
|
||
|
||
# Copy data
|
||
rclone copy s3-source:my-bucket r2-dest:my-bucket --progress
|
||
|
||
# Verify
|
||
rclone check s3-source:my-bucket r2-dest:my-bucket
|
||
```
|
||
|
||
### Cost of Migration
|
||
|
||
```
|
||
Data transfer out from S3: 500TB × $0.09/GB = $45,000
|
||
Data transfer into R2: $0 (ingress is free)
|
||
|
||
One-time migration cost: $45,000
|
||
|
||
Monthly savings after migration:
|
||
S3 storage + egress: $20,833/month
|
||
R2 storage: $7,500/month
|
||
Savings: $13,333/month
|
||
|
||
ROI: 3.4 months
|
||
```

## Troubleshooting
|
||
|
||
### Issue: Connection errors
|
||
|
||
**Solution:**
|
||
```typescript
|
||
// Ensure correct endpoint format
|
||
const storage = new S3CompatibleStorage({
|
||
endpoint: `https://${accountId}.r2.cloudflarestorage.com`,
|
||
// NOT: `https://r2.cloudflarestorage.com/${accountId}`
|
||
|
||
region: 'auto', // R2 requires 'auto'
|
||
forcePathStyle: false // R2 uses virtual-hosted-style
|
||
})
|
||
```
|
||
|
||
### Issue: High Class A operation costs
|
||
|
||
**Solution:**
|
||
- Use batch operations (writes are most expensive)
|
||
- Cache frequently written data
|
||
- Consolidate small writes into larger batches
|
||
- Consider Workers KV for high-frequency writes
|
||
|
||
### Issue: Need lifecycle management now
|
||
|
||
**Solution:**
|
||
- Manually move old data to S3 Deep Archive
|
||
- Use hybrid approach: R2 for hot, S3 for cold
|
||
- Wait for R2 lifecycle features (planned)
